James olds and peter milner (1954) were trying to implant an electrode in a rat's reticular formation when they mistakenly place

d the electrode incorrectly. curiously, as if seeking more stimulation, the rat kept returning to the location where it had been when it received a stimulus from this misplaced electrode. on discovering that they had actually placed the device in a region of the _____, olds and milner realized they had stumbled upon a _____.
Social Studies
2 answers:
In-s [12.5K]4 years ago
6 0
The answer is <span>hypothalamus; reward center
When mammals do actions that make them obtain something desirable, the hypothalamus part of the mammals brain will release dopamine that make us feel calm, happy, and satisfied. This will make us more likely to repeat that actions in order to seek this dopamine reward.

when an employee is able to redefine their jobs in a proactive way, such as altering the boundaries of their jobs, the employee
docker41 [41]

An employee is engaged in job crafting when they are able to redefine their jobs in a proactive way and alter the boundaries of their job.

Job crafting is a personal driven process that is involved with work design. Here, a person would initiate proactive means that would enable them to change the features of their jobs.

This person would change the characteristics of his job in order to have it align with their own personal goals, ambitions and skills.
